Course content
Content "Selection of the bachelor thesis topic "Personal work plan of the student "Working with information "Methodology and its use in the bachelor thesis "Recommendations and proposals for solutions as the goal of the bachelor thesis "Work with literature (citations, paraphrases, citation ethics) "Formal modification of the bachelor thesis "Principles of creating a presentation and its preparation for the defense "How to successfully defend a bachelor thesis? "Individual consultations on the topics of bachelor theses
